Mario For C
Controlled Variables was specially designed as an accessible header file for C++ developers.
This file allows you to create controlled variables instead of int, float, long, etc. Controlled variables ensure you always use initialized variables.
Platforms: Windows
License: Freeware | Download (45): Controlled Variables Download |
GigaBASE is a handy object-relational embedded database engine designed for C++ applications. The tool provides SQL-like query language, smart C++ interface, transaction based on shadowing page algorithm.
GigaBASE inherits most of the features of FastDB, but uses page pool instead of direct...
Platforms: Windows
License: Freeware | Download (45): GigaBASE Download |
Code::Blocks is an open source, free, configurable programming environment for C/C++. The Code::Blocks EDU-Portable interface, integrated help, tools and default compilation settings are all configured for ease of learning C and C++.
The EDU-Portable configuration of Code::Blocks provides...
Platforms: Windows
License: Freeware | Size: 116 MB | Download (60): Code::Blocks EDU Portable Download |
opmock was developed as a mocking and testing instrument for C and C++.
The software can be useful if a user wants to implement micro testing and TDD in a similar way of what exists in Java or C#.
It was designed with legacy code in mind, and should work with all C++ and C compilers.
Platforms: Windows
License: Freeware | Download (49): opmock Download |
Cpp Easy Serialization was specially developed as an easy-to-use, accessible and useful serialization framework for C++.
Now you can make use of this framework to further improve your development process and increase your productivity.
Platforms: Windows
License: Freeware | Download (43): Cpp Easy Serialization Download |
CxxTest is a JUnit/CppUnit/xUnit-like framework for C .It is extremely portable since it doesn't depend on RTTI, exception handling or any libraries (including standard ones). Its advantages over existing alternatives are that it: - Doesn't require RTTI - Doesn't require member template...
Platforms: Windows, Mac, *nix, C/C++, BSD Solaris
License: Freeware | Download (49): CxxTest Download |
pycrc provides a CRC reference implementation in Python and a source code generator for C. The used CRC variant can be chosen from a fast but space-consuming implementation to slower but smaller implementations suitable especially for embedded applications. The following functions are...
Platforms: Windows, Mac, *nix, Python, BSD Solaris
License: Freeware | Download (58): pycrc Download |
Software Studio is an Integrated Development Environment (IDE) for C#, Java, VB.Net, Aspx, C , Html, Xml, Php, JavaScript, Tex with multi-language support,syntax higlighting,code folding,code completetion,refactoring support.Main features: - Syntax highlighting - Code folding - Code completion...
Platforms: Windows, C#,
License: Freeware | Download (49): Software Studio Download |
These libraries are intended to be used across a broad spectrum of applications.Boost works on almost any modern operating system,both UNIX and Windows variants.
Platforms: C and C plus plus
License: Freeware | Size: 57.56 MB | Download (43): Boost for C/C++ Library Download |
iCodeLibrary.NET is an application for C++, C#, Java, Visual Basic and other language developers. The application allows you to store snippets of code in a hierarchical structure in a local database viewed in a treeview. Code can be searched, exported to HTML, or XML for importing into other...
Platforms: Windows
License: Freeware | Size: 283 KB | Download (354): iCodeLibrary Download |
Terminal-Complex Ltd offers you Visual Programming Armoury for C++ and Java - a heavy-duty tool of a software developer's trade. TCVPA is dedicated for professionals who employ object-oriented methodology, client-server computing, object-relational mapping, complex data storages, diagrams for...
Platforms: Windows
License: Freeware | Size: 2.8 MB | Download (150): Visual Programming Armoury Download |
Source Code Beautifier for C, C++, C#, D, Java, and Pawn. Ident code, aligning on parens, assignments, etc. Align on '=' and variable definitions. Align structure initializers. Align #define stuff. Align backslash-newline stuff. Reformat comments (a little bit). Fix inter-character spacing. Add...
Platforms: *nix, Windows
License: Freeware | Size: 99 KB | Download (147): Uncrustify Download |
CodeLite is a powerful free editor for C and C++ programming languages. It has a great user interface, designed to cover simple and complex projects. It is outstanding for its flexibility of use and versatility.The main features of CodeLite:* Generic support for compilers.* You can widen its...
Platforms: Windows
License: Freeware | Size: 9 KB | Download (102): CodeLite Download |
In just one application, Open Watcom gives you a development environment for programming in languages for C, C++ and Fortran. It includes the tools, SDKs, and libraries necessary to create programs of 16 and 32 bits for any PC platform.Open Watcom combines an integrated development environment...
Platforms: Windows
License: Freeware | Size: 6 KB | Download (762): Open Watcom Download |
Xrtti is an extended runtime type information for C++. Xrtti is a tool and accompanying C++ library which extends the standard runtime type system of C++ to provide a much richer set of reflection information about classes and methods to manipulate these classes and their members. Using Xrtti...
Platforms: *nix
License: Freeware | Size: 112.64 KB | Download (105): Xrtti Download |
DAEMon Raco Libraries (DRLibs) is a collection of useful functions, objects, and routines for C++. Whats New in This Release: - This release adds new libraries to manage object lists: doublelist.dr.h, simplelist.dr.h, and sortedlist.dr.h..
Platforms: *nix
License: Freeware | Size: 28.67 KB | Download (93): DAEMon Raco Libraries Download |
BNet is an exact Bayesian inference library for C++. This library implements the junction tree algorithm for discrete variable Bayesian networks. Examples are provided to illustrate its capabilities. Installation: type make to compile everything type make doc to compile the documentation...
Platforms: *nix
License: Freeware | Size: 296.96 KB | Download (96): BNet Download |
A lightweight internationalization tool for C code, for those who find gettext too bulky and intrusive. Extracts strings from a program and turns them into #defines in a pre-pended code section. Has good features for building up your message base incrementally. This tool can be used to massage...
Platforms: *nix
License: Freeware | Size: 18.43 KB | Download (98): cstrings Download |
liberror is a library for C and C++ that solves the allegedly simply task of printing messages. Thus, it is essentially a feature-rich substitute for fprintf(stderr,...). Features include colours via ANSI mark-up, multiple error streams, report files, automatic error number assignment,...
Platforms: *nix
License: Freeware | Size: 778.24 KB | Download (96): liberror Download |
gloox is a high-level Jabber/XMPP library for C++. Additionally, it offers high-level interfaces for interaction with an XMPP server. gloox is released under the GNU GPL. Commercial licenses are available. gloox is fully compliant to XMPP Core and almost fully compliant to XMPP IM..
Platforms: *nix
License: Freeware | Size: 266.24 KB | Download (107): gloox Download |